A surgery which is needed when the heart becomes too weak to pump enough blood to meet the body's needs and all other options have been attempted and proven unsuccessful. Several factors will be considered and many tests performed to determine if someone is an appropriate candidate for a heart transplant. When surgery is deemed necessary, the failing heart is removed through incisions in the atria (the upper chambers of the heart), aorta and pulmonary arteries, and the donor heart is then stitched at these sites. Costly medications and frequent follow-up appointments are needed to keep the body from rejecting the new heart once it is in place.
